Decode Message From Audio File :


Here What is Decryption:??


-decryption is the reverse process to Encryption.

-InSort->decryption creates a PlainText from a Ciphertext.




  • Follow the  steps For Decryption Process


-You need to download Sonic Visualizer for Windows to decode your message:

-Download From:http://www.sonicvisualiser.org/download.html

-Go to File->Import Audio File and select the .wav file you have created from Coagula.

-Now click on Layer->Add Spectrogram


-Just Like This:





-Clicking on any option would work out.

-You can now adjust the side of the spectrogram to see the message clearly.

C program to shutdown or turn off computer:


C program to shutdown or turn off 

computer:



#include <stdio.h>

#include <stdlib.h>

main ()

{

char ch ;

printf ("Do you want to shutdown your computer now (y/n) \n ");

scanf ( "%c" ,&ch);

if (ch == 'y' || ch == 'Y')

system("C:\\WINDOWS\\System32\\shutdown -s"); // WindowsXP

//system("C:\\WINDOWS\\System32\\shutdown /s"); //Windows7

//system("shutdown -P now"); //Ubuntu Linux

return 0;

}



Note: To restart You can use /r instead of /s  .

Shut Down or Restart Another Computer:

Shut Down or Restart Another Computer:


You can  shut down or restart another computer on your network,  from your computer's Command Prompt...!!!


(1) first open command Prompt.

(2) Then type: shutdown/i  from Your Command Prompt..

(3) Which will Open the Remote Shutdown Dialog.That Shown..





(4) Than, just Enter the name of the Remote Computer or ip address..

(5) And Choose What you want to do like: restart or Shutdown.

(6) In OptionShutdown Event Tracker..
  • -Select The Option that best describes why you want to Shutdown the computer.
  • -Also add comment Like.."Your computer will shutdown in 5 seconds...ha ha ha ha ha..
(7) Select some other options and then click OK.

Automatically Complete Commands with Tab Completion:


                                                            
  • Tab completion is Command Prompt trick that can save you lots of time, especially if your command has a file or folder name in it that you are not completely sure that.



  • To use tab key in the Command Prompt, just enter the command and then the portion of the path that you do know,


  • Then press the tab key over and over to get all of the available possibilities.


For example: if you want to change directories to some folder in the Windows directory;
but you are not sure what it is named. than, 

simply, apply this trick..........

(1)  Open the command prompt.

(2) Reach the path for Example, Type cd:\windows\

(3) And press tab Until you see the folder Which are you looking for.

(4) And Shift+Tab through we can go in reverse direction..
